From slingmedia:
Windows System Requirements
--------------------------------------------------------------------------------
Minimum PC Requirments:
Microsoft Windows® Vista™ or Windows® XP with Service Pack 2
Intel® Pentium IV 1.3 GHz processor
1 GB RAM for Windows® Vista™ and 512 MB for Windows® XP
150 MB available disk space for installation
Graphics card (24-bit color)
Sound card (16-bit)
Network connectivity
Minimum Network Requirements:
Cable or DSL modem (for out-of-home viewing)
256 Kbps upstream network speed recommended (higher upstream network speeds yield higher quality video)
Home network router – wired or wireless (UPnP™ compatibility highly recommended)
Mac System Requirements
--------------------------------------------------------------------------------
Minimum Mac Requirements:
A Macintosh computer with a 700MHz or faster PowerPC G4, PowerPC G5, Intel-based processor
Mac OS X v10.3.9 (or later recommended)
125MB of free disk space
512MB of RAM (1GB or more recommended)
Network connectivity
Minimum Network Requirements:
Cable or DSL modem (for out-of-home viewing)
256 Kbps upstream network speed recommended (higher upstream network speeds yield higher quality video)
Home network router – wired or wireless (UPnP™ compatibility highly recommended)

Is there a monthly service fee for Slingbox? You could hook up a camera and that would be a nice video server which you could watch cameras anywhere.
C7 in CA - 28 Mar 2008, 08:35 pm
No subscription fee's, but if you want to use your PDA they get another 30 bucks for software. Software for the PC and MAC is free.
